I'm starting to get a little obsessed about parkour. I'm currently learning the basics and absolute fundamentals. At first I got bored of doing the rolls and jumps over and over and over. Over time though I started to realize that although the basic moves look extremely simple. There is so much technique and practice required in order to master them. I was having trouble learning it as I kept injuring myself because I would just fully commit to the roll without a hint of an idea on how to actually do it. I found the best way to break down the move into small manageable progressions that would eventually lead the the completion of the whole move. So instead of trying to do the whole roll at once and think about which part hurt the most. I start with just learning how to roll around on my shoulder and back.
